Buying Guide
What should you consider when choosing an Ek o-ring chain?
- Riding type: Street-only, dirt, or mixed use determines O-ring versus non O-ring needs.
- Link count: Choose chain length to match your sprocket setup and wheelbase requirements.
- Seal type: O-ring chains resist dirt and retain lubrication longer; non O-ring are simpler and often cheaper.
- Master link preference: Clip versus rivet links affect installation and long-term security under load.
- Maintenance expectations: Consider how often you can clean and lubricate your chain in your riding conditions.
How do these Ek options compare on key dimensions?
- Durability: O-ring variants generally offer superior life in dirty or wet conditions compared to non O-ring.
- Performance: For performance riding, O-ring variants with appropriate pitch deliver smoother operation and better power transfer.
- Installation: Clipmasters are easier for quick maintenance; rivet links demand proper tools but can be more secure.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is an O-ring chain and why is it important?
An O-ring chain has rubber seals between each link to keep lubrication in and dirt out, extending chain life in challenging conditions.
Which Ek chain is best for mixed street and dirt riding?
Chains with O-ring seals and mid-to-high pitch, like the 520SRO6 variants, are good for mixed usage due to durability and sealing.
Are clip master links safe for long-term use?
Yes, but ensure proper installation and periodic inspection. Rivet links may offer greater long-term security in high-stress riding.
How do I know which chain length I need?
Refer to your motorcycle’s sprocket count and OEM chain length. Matching the correct link count is essential for proper tension and chain life.
What maintenance should I perform on an Ek o-ring chain?
Regular cleaning and re-lubrication in clean, dry environments help maximize life. Avoid harsh cleaners that can degrade seals.
